NAME
i2o_status_get - Get the status block from the I2O controller
SYNOPSIS
int i2o_status_get(struct i2o_controller * c);
ARGUMENTS
c I2O controller
DESCRIPTION
Issue a status query on the controller. This updates the attached status block. The status block could then be accessed through c->status_block. Returns 0 on success or negative error code on failure.
